average use

The data indicates that the most recent mileage readings for the Chrysler Grand Voyager (2001-08) are relatively evenly distributed across several mileage ranges, with notable peaks at 150,000 to 160,000 miles (14.1%) and 160,000 to 170,000 miles (10.9%). The percentage of vehicles with very low mileage (0 to 10,000 miles) is quite small at 1.6%, suggesting few very low-mileage vehicles in the sample. Conversely, there is a modest presence of higher-mileage vehicles between 180,000 to 200,000 miles (7.8%) and above 200,000 miles, indicating that these models are capable of accumulating significant mileage over time. Overall, the data reflects a typical distribution for a vehicle of this age, with a concentration in the 150,000+ mile range and relatively fewer vehicles at the extremes of low or very high mileage.

vehicle values

The data indicates that the majority of private sale valuations for the Chrysler Grand Voyager (2001-08) 5DR MPV 2.5 CRD LIMITED fall within the UK pounds 0 to 1000 range, accounting for approximately 73.4% of listings. A smaller proportion, 26.6%, are valued between £1,000 and £2,000. This distribution suggests that most private sales are at the lower end of the price spectrum, likely reflecting the age and potentially higher mileage or condition issues typical for vehicles of this model and age group.

production years

The data indicates that the majority of Chrysler Grand Voyager (2001-08) 5DR MPV 2.5 CRD Limited vehicles in the sample were manufactured in 2003, accounting for approximately 42.2%. Other notable years include 2002 at 25%, 2001 at 15.6%, and 2004 at 17.2%. This suggests that a significant proportion of these vehicles on the road today are from the 2003 model year, potentially reflecting manufacturing trends or vehicle longevity. The distribution is relatively spread out across these years, with a noticeable concentration around 2001 to 2003.

colour popularity

The data indicates that for the Chrysler Grand Voyager (2001-08) 5DR MPV 2.5 CRD LIMITED, the most common main paint colours are Silver (29.7%), Blue (23.4%), and Black (20.3%), collectively accounting for over 70% of the vehicles. Green is relatively notable at 9.4%, while Grey covers 14.1%. Less common colours include Beige and Red, each at 1.6%. This suggests a preference among owners for classic, neutral tones, with silver leading as the most popular colour choice for this model.
